During the 2020-2021 academic year, Point Loma Nazarene University handed out 13 bachelor's degrees in social work. This is an increase of 44% over the previous year when 9 degrees were handed out.
Take a look at the following statistics related to the make-up of the social work majors at Point Loma Nazarene University.
During the 2020-2021 academic year, 13 students graduated with a bachelor's degree in social work from PLNU. About 15% were men and 85% were women.
